|a Charlayne Hunter-Gault (born 1942) is an American activist and journalist. In 1961, Hunter-Gault and Hamilton Holmes became the first African American students to enroll at the University of Georgia. Hunter-Gault worked as a journalist for The New York Times and served as a foreign correspondent for CNN, NPR, and PBS NewsHour.

|a 15 black and white photographs by an unidentified photographer that document Charlayne Hunter-Gault integrating the University of Georgia in 1961. Also includes photographs of Hunter-Gault attending Mass at a Catholic Church.
